pub struct EraEndV2 { /* private fields */ }Expand description
Information related to the end of an era, and validator weights for the following era.
Implementations§
Source§impl EraEndV2
impl EraEndV2
Sourcepub fn equivocators(&self) -> &[PublicKey]
pub fn equivocators(&self) -> &[PublicKey]
Returns the set of equivocators.
Sourcepub fn inactive_validators(&self) -> &[PublicKey]
pub fn inactive_validators(&self) -> &[PublicKey]
Returns the validators that haven’t produced any unit during the era.
Sourcepub fn next_era_validator_weights(&self) -> &BTreeMap<PublicKey, U512>
pub fn next_era_validator_weights(&self) -> &BTreeMap<PublicKey, U512>
Returns the validators for the upcoming era and their respective weights.
Sourcepub fn rewards(&self) -> &BTreeMap<PublicKey, Vec<U512>>
pub fn rewards(&self) -> &BTreeMap<PublicKey, Vec<U512>>
Returns the rewards distributed to the validators.
Sourcepub fn next_era_gas_price(&self) -> u8
pub fn next_era_gas_price(&self) -> u8
Returns the next era gas price.
